
Some folks look for shapes in clouds. I search for faces in rocks.
This one isn’t just a face. It looks like an entire head with hair of ferns and moss. Can you see it? There’s a squinty eye, nose, cheek and a mouth fixed in a grimace just above a double chin. It reminds me a little of those modern 4D ultrasounds that give parents a better view of their child’s features.
Odd, I know.
This rock and many other fabulous sights can be found at Lake Katherine State Nature Preserve near Jackson, Ohio.
